About Company
This document introduces a small Illinois-based fabrications workshop founded in 2016 to support aircraft restoration projects, including several World War II warbirds, with a commitment to using new technologies to create beautiful, accessible parts and to reinvest all profits into rebuilding these projects.
Key Points
The founders have a long-standing passion for designing and building mechanical parts since high school.
The business is located in Illinois, about 45 minutes north of Chicago.
The company was established in 2016 to pursue aircraft engineering and restoration efforts.
The initial focus includes restoring Warbirds such as the P-40 Warhawk (N5), Bf 109, Fw 190 A8, Spitfire Mk VIII, and potentially a North American P-51D Mustang.
The vision emphasizes becoming a go-to workshop for fabricated parts for vintage aircraft and other projects.
All profits are reinvested into ongoing restoration and project rebuilding efforts.
